The highest elevation for a traffic signal is (ironically) the eastbound approach to the Eisenhower Tunnel on I-70, at just under 11,200 feet.

The lowest elevation for a traffic signal is found at the intersection of 4th Street and Grapefruit Boulevard in Mecca, California, at a little above -200 feet.
